What is a .svg file?

SVG (Scalable Vector Graphics) is an XML-based vector image format describing shapes, paths, text, and styling that scale losslessly to any resolution. It can embed CSS, scripting, and references, so it is both an image and an executable document. It is standard for icons, diagrams, and resolution-independent web graphics.

How to use this file

Use an example SVG to test vector rasterization, sanitization of untrusted markup, and rendering fidelity, treating any untrusted SVG as potentially executable content requiring safe handling.
